Output 18751ea5ecf26a5e3f228ef25dd0543227f8500e73c3dc052583282d622f48a6:0

value
8533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743e707572dae7e93b132b09244e75eb154e018c OP_EQUAL
address
3CHf79tqJdZfYqhAB1AG2CPADfyyZfptT5
transaction
18751ea5ecf26a5e3f228ef25dd0543227f8500e73c3dc052583282d622f48a6
spent
true